Derek isolates self after coming in contact with Dushyant Singh
New Delhi: Trinamool Congress Rajya Sabha MP Derek O'Brien went into self-quarantine on Friday. In a Twitter post, he shared a video where he stated that he was staying in isolation at his residence after he met BJP MP Dushyant Singh during the Transport Parliamentary Standing Committee meeting and sat beside him for almost two hours. Dushyant had attended a party by singer Kanika Kapoor, who tested positive for COVID-19 on Friday.
Derek mentioned that the government was putting everyone at risk as Parliament session was still underway. He said he sat next to Dushyant but was wearing a mask. Thereafter, O'Brien demanded the deferment of the Parliament session as several MPs, including Apna Dal's Anupriya Patel, have gone into self-quarantine.
"There are two more MPs who are in self-isolation. The session should be deferred," he added.
Hitting out at the government, O'Brien said that on one side they are talking of self-isolation and on the other hand they are continuing with the Parliament session.
"Parliament has hardly discussed Coronavirus. The Lok Sabha and Rajya Sabha discussed COVID-19 for only 3 per cent of total time. Is this how governments inspire confidence in crisis? Defer session! Stop conflicting messaging," O'Brien said. His party colleague Sukhendu Shekhar Roy too has announced self-isolation.
"I was present at an event yesterday and Dushyant Singh was also present at the event. As a precaution, I am going for self-isolation. I will follow the necessary guidelines by the government," tweeted Anupriya Patel.
Earlier, MoS External Affairs V Muraleedharan had self-quarantined after he visited a Kerala-based medical institute whose hospital later reported a Coronavirus case.
Former Union Minister Suresh Prabhu too quarantined himself at his residence for the next 14 days as a precautionary measure following his return from Saudi Arabia to attend a meeting on March 10.
Dushyant, along with his mother Vasundhara Raje, has gone into self-isolation after attending a dinner with the singer. Kanika Kapoor has become the first Bollywood celebrity to test positive for Coronavirus in the country and says she's under complete quarantine and medical care.
There were reports that she landed in Lucknow from the United Kingdom and was admitted in a city hospital after she showed signs of flu. According to sources, after attending the party in Lucknow along with the singer who is now undergoing treatment, Dushyant also attended an industrialist and former MP's birthday party and one more party. Dushyant also attended the BJP parliamentary party meeting on March 17.
Meanwhile, Uttar Pradesh Health Minister Jai Pratap Singh on Friday took a test for coronavirus as it emerged that he also was at the party went into self-isolation.
Noida MLA and BJP state general secretary Pankaj Singh, Jewar MLA Dhirendra Singh and Dadri MLA Tejpal Nagar took to Twitter to say they are going into-self isolation as a precautionary measure as they had met the health minister on Thursday in Greater Noida.
